I was referred through a current WK employee. First interview was with a WK recrutier who went over background, resume, etc. and set up the online assessments. The next step was a behavioral interview with three people that lasted about an hour. I made it past this step to the final interview with the hiring manager. I was told three people made it through to the final interview. The interview experience was mostly positive except that getting follow up and feedback was like pulling teeth.

Was told there are anywhere from 5-7 interviews - 1 phone interview is mostly informational with internal recruiter, 1 is face to face with district manager, 2-3 are phone interviews with other district managers from other regions, then face to face with VP of sales.
